Family Leaves Behind Legacy at Lincoln-Way East

A local family's legacy will forever be on display at Lincoln-Way East.

Their children may have moved on from Lincoln-Way East, but a local couple's heart is still with the school. 

John and Pamala (Liston) Walsh chose to honor their family's Lincoln-Way history with the Lincoln-Way Foundation's Commemorative Brick Program, Sun-Times Media reports. 

“Our family is very proud of our Lincoln-Way history, and very grateful for the opportunities afforded us as a result of the high educational standards held by this district,” Class of '75 graduation John Walsh told Sun-Times reporters. 

The Walsh family commemorative bricks are on display in the auditorium lobby at Lincoln-Way East High School.

Their five children and Lincoln-Way East High School graduates include: Michael (Class of 2003), Colleen (2005), Kelsey (2011), Katherine (2013) and Kacie Walsh (2013).
